You can feel confident that the information provided to you by TurboTax is correct. There are no known issues being addressed with regard to incorrect Roth IRA contribution limits.
The amount you are allowed or whether you are allowed to contribute to a Roth IRA is based on more than your earned income for the year. Your Modified Adjusted Gross Income (MAGI) and filing status also come into play.
